Output 95aefde7ce528e31d80f7c2f6821c64bcb64ef40471ddd577bce9e444451420d:0

value
1924200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c3dd877112a197d07ba62f3e380bf9c8808123b OP_EQUAL
address
34GLw28ccoDm7RYrM8hSSv42odjMtAVLzL
transaction
95aefde7ce528e31d80f7c2f6821c64bcb64ef40471ddd577bce9e444451420d